Hydrophones are a piezo-electric … WebJul 3, 2024 · Unlike transmitters however, hydrophones work not just in this small frequency band. They perform well over the entire frequency band below their first resonance point. Hydrophones are a non-resonant device. It is not uncommon for the usable frequency range of a hydrophone to span hundreds of thousands of Hertz.
